The Maastricht University Holland High Potential Scholarship 2026 is a prestigious fully funded program that offers exceptional international students the opportunity to pursue a Master’s degree in the Netherlands. Valued at €29,000, the scholarship covers full tuition fees and living expenses, making it one of the most comprehensive awards available for global students seeking a high-quality European education.
Maastricht University, founded in 1976 and located in the historic city of Maastricht, is a leading public research institution known for its innovative Problem-Based Learning (PBL) approach that fosters critical thinking and collaboration. Despite being one of the youngest universities in the Netherlands, it has earned a strong reputation for academic excellence and internationalism, with over 16,000 students representing more than 100 countries—nearly 47% of whom are international.
Benefits of the Scholarship
This scholarship will provide the following to its recipients:
- Full tuition fee coverage (€13,800, €15,500, €16,800, depending on the study program)
- Living expenses stipend (€12,350 – €23,750 depending on the study program)
- Health insurance coverage for the entire scholarship period
- Visa application costs (€171)
- Pre-academic training costs (€695)

Eligibility Criteria
To be eligible for this scholarship, applicants must:
- Be an international student from outside the European Economic Area (EEA) and Switzerland
- Meet the requirements to obtain an entry visa and residence permit for the Netherlands
- Not be older than 35 years of age on September 1, 2026
- Hold a Bachelor’s degree or equivalent qualification that meets admission requirements for the chosen Master’s program
- Apply to one of the participating Master’s programs at Maastricht University eligible for this scholarship
- Have never previously participated in any degree program in the Netherlands
- Demonstrate exceptional academic performance and high potential for future success
- Meet the specific admission requirements for your chosen Master’s program
- Provide proof of English language proficiency as required by the university
- Submit a complete scholarship application by the deadline
- Be conditionally approved for admission to secure the scholarship award

Selection Criteria
The Maastricht University scholarship selection committee assesses candidates holistically, considering their academic excellence and achievements, demonstrated potential for future success through leadership and innovation, clear motivation and alignment with their chosen program and career goals, as well as their capacity to positively contribute to Maastricht’s diverse, international, and collaborative academic community.
